In 2019 Syncfusion implemented Visa Authorize.Net for Payment Processing on its website. The deployment targets online payment capture for software licensing and professional services billing, centralizing payment acceptance within the company website checkout and customer portal workflows. Visa Authorize.Net was configured as the primary payment gateway, supporting transaction authorization and capture, refunds, and card tokenization for card on file scenarios. The implementation includes a mix of hosted payment form components and API based transaction handling to accommodate one time purchases and recurring billing patterns common to software and services revenue. Operational coverage for Visa Authorize.Net centers on website checkout, order to cash processing, and integrations into finance and billing workflows, affecting finance, billing, and customer success teams. Governance practices described include centralized transaction logging and reconciliation workflows, role based access controls to limit PCI scope, and monitoring to support operational troubleshooting and auditability.

In 2020, Syncfusion implemented Tawk.to as a customer-facing chat solution on their public website. Tawk.to is deployed as a Chatbots and Conversational AI application, providing an embedded live chat interface to capture real-time visitor interactions and support inquiries. The implementation uses the Tawk.to JavaScript widget embedded site-wide and a cloud-hosted vendor console for agents, consistent with a SaaS chat architecture. Functional capabilities in use include live chat sessions, canned responses, visitor monitoring and presence indicators, offline messaging and message transcripts, and administrative configuration through the Tawk.to admin console. Operational scope centers on web-based customer engagement, with ownership and governance managed by Syncfusion customer support and pre-sales teams. Configuration, agent assignment, and message retention are administered via the Tawk.to interface, integrating the chat layer directly into web pages to support lead capture and inbound support workflows.

In 2015, Syncfusion deployed Microsoft 365 as its primary Collaboration platform, and the company is using Microsoft 365 on their website. The implementation establishes Microsoft 365, provided by Microsoft, as the core collaboration layer for internal communication and content delivery at Syncfusion. The deployment centers on standard Microsoft 365 capabilities, with Exchange Online for enterprise email and calendaring, SharePoint Online for intranet and document management, Microsoft Teams for synchronous and asynchronous communications, and OneDrive for Business for personal file sync and sharing. Configuration emphasis includes centralized tenant administration, role based access controls, and policy enforcement for document lifecycle and external sharing, reflecting typical Collaboration category governance. Operational coverage extends across corporate functions including IT, engineering, product, marketing, and sales at a roughly 1000 employee organization scale, with Microsoft 365 supporting team collaboration, document workflows, and external content surfaced via the company website. Governance practices emphasize tenant level administration, collaboration policy controls, and content governance to align Microsoft 365 capabilities with Syncfusion business functions and web presence.

Syncfusion is a Professional Services organization based in United States, with around 1000 employees and annual revenues of $250.0 million.
Syncfusion operates a diverse technology stack with applications such as Visa Authorize.Net, Tawk.to and Microsoft 365, covering areas like Payment Processing, Chatbots and Conversational AI and Collaboration.
Syncfusion has invested in cloud applications and AI-driven platforms to optimize efficiency and growth, collaborating with vendors such as Visa, Tawk.to and Microsoft.
Syncfusion recently adopted applications including Jetbrains Datagrip in 2025, DigitalOcean Droplets in 2022 and Amazon S3 in 2022, highlighting its ongoing modernization strategy.
